The Kwara State University, Ilorin, has announced the release of its Post UTME admission form for the 2024/2025 academic session. This presents an opportunity for eligible candidates to apply and compete for admission into the university.
Eligibility Criteria:
To be eligible for the KWASU Post UTME, candidates must meet the following criteria:
- Choose Kwara State University, Ilorin as their first choice during the 2024 Unified Tertiary Matriculation Examination (UTME).
- Attain a minimum UTME score of 180.
Application Process:
Qualified candidates are required to follow these steps to apply for the KWASU Post UTME:
- Pay a non-refundable fee of N2,000 via the university’s portal at https://portal.kwasu.edu.ng.
- Payment can be made online using debit cards (Visa, Verve, MasterCard) or by printing the Remita Retrieval Reference (RRR) slip and paying at any commercial bank listed on the portal.
- Complete the online application form on the portal or apply directly on the school campus.
Required Documents:
Upon submission of the application form, candidates are required to present the following original documents at the screening centers:
- O’ level results
- JAMB result/acknowledgment slip
- A’ level results, diploma, or IJMB (if applicable)
- O’ level certificate/statement of result(s)
- Two passport photographs
- Indigene letter
- Certificate of birth/declaration of age
Screening Date:
The screening date for the KWASU Post UTME will be communicated to all qualified candidates via the email and phone number provided during registration. It’s crucial to ensure that your contact information is valid and up-to-date.
